Who wants to carry a few hundred pounds of dead weight around, making your tractor feel sluggish and less agile for nothing??

Installing an 800-1000 pound grapple on a large compact or utility tractor under 80hp just doesn't make sense.
The perfect grapple for those tractors was needed, so now we are making one in the 500-600 pound range that will maximize efficiency without sacrificing strength and durability.

Ted stayed true to the original proven Wicked Grapple design and the finished product is Outstanding!!

The 73" Wicked Utility Grapple is complete. It's now ready for pics and a product video with Ted.
After that, Ted will punish it with his new L6060 Kubota.


We will offer this grapple in 55" and 73" widths.
The lids will open 42.5" wide courtesy of 2.5" x 10" cylinders.
The 73" weighs 665 pounds.

We are taking orders now!

55" Introductory Price is $2,490.00
73" Introductory Price is $2,631.00

Universal Skid Steer Quick Attach will be standard.
Special build fee for the JD 400/500 style carrier and Global Carrier is $125 additional.

We toyed with the idea a while back and decided that the kits are, for us, really more time consuming and labor intensive than shipping the completed product.
Although they look fairly simple, there's quite a bit that goes into these grapples. Just ask Roger, aka 94BULLITT, a TBN member who put one together.
